NAHJ offers scholarships and fellowships for Hispanic journalists. They give students the choice of either receiving scholarship funds for their academic year or participating in a sponsored trip to the NAHJ national conference. This sponsored trip covers registration fees, travel expenses, hotel accommodations, and meals. Attending the conference provides a valuable experience that frequently opens up additional opportunities for our students.
AAJA provides scholarships and grants to support Asian American and Pacific Islander journalists.
NABJ offers scholarships and fellowships specifically for Black journalists.
